In a urethral pressure detection device that detects internal pressure over the entire length of the urethra by inserting a catheter into the urethra and withdrawing the catheter at a constant speed, one end is connected to each of the measurement holes drilled near the tip. a blind-end catheter having a plurality of tubes, a plurality of fluid injection devices connected to each of the tubes and injecting fluid into the tube, and a fluid injection device connected to each of the tubes and injecting fluid into the tube; 1. A urethral pressure detection device comprising a plurality of pressure quadrature transducers that sense pressure generated in the urethra.
